摘要
按国家电网规划,高电压等级新建变电站项目均按智能化变电站建设实施。而目前投运以及在建的智能化变电站中,主要二次设备配置方案以及设备选型也各不相同。以海北500 kV智能化变电站为工程实例,在网络架构配置、保护跳闸方式、互感器选型、时钟对时以及一次设备在线监测等方面进行了方案比较与研究,为其他智能化变电站的建设提供了参考。
According to the national power grid planning, the project of high voltage level new substation will be built as intelligent substation. As for the current intelligent substations in operation or under construction, the current oper- ation and in the construction of intelligent substation, the main secondary equipment configuration and equipment se- lection are also different. This article takes the Haibei 500 kV intelligent substation for example to compare and study many considerations about the scheme such as the framework of network configuration, protection tripping mode, transformer,clock timing and on line monitoring of primary equipment,which provides a good reference for the con- struction of other intelligent substation.
